Car’s Cooling System: How Does It Work

In all the cooling systems, a cooling circuit runs through the head and the engine block, which are sealed using a gasket. The coolant or the antifreeze is circulated through a pump and coolant hoses. The coolant goes through the engine as well as the radiator. The outside air tends to cool the coolant, thus removing the heat from the engine. This cycle tends to continue, thus keeping your car cool, regardless of the weather and the temperature.

Cooling System Maintenance

Now that we have talked about the car’s cooling system, let’s discuss some of the cooling system maintenance tips.

A cooling system that is clean doesn’t fall prey to dust and debris, and therefore, there is no blockage or clogging. Here are a few ways to maintain the cooling system of your car and make sure that it is running perfectly.

  • Make sure to keep an eye on coolant consumption and leakages.
  • Regularly check the coolant level, and top it up if required.
  • Test the coolant, especially during the cold winter months.
  • Make sure the coolant isn’t rusty or discolored. If it is, get the cooling system checked for corrosion.
  • After every five years, make sure to flush theentire cooling system. You must remember that the five year figure is just an estimate. The cooling system needs flushing whenever your car hits the 30,000 miles mark, which could be before or after five years.
  • Don’t overload your car
  • Check your radiator regularly
